Discovering the Hypogeum: Rome’s Hidden Engineering Marvel

Beneath the wooden floor once lay the hypogeum: a hidden maze of tunnels, cages, and trapdoors. This underground world made the Colosseum unlike any other arena in history. Gladiator battles were just part of the spectacle. The hypogeum held wild animals, slaves, props, and could even be flooded to stage naval battles.

Taking a Colosseum hypogeum tour reveals the Romans’ incredible engineering and showmanship. These underground layers show how they combined creativity and technology to entertain crowds of thousands. Without seeing the hypogeum, it’s easy to miss how much effort and skill went on behind the scenes.

Planning Your Visit: Know Colosseum Hours and Ticket Tips

Here’s the practical side. Access to the Colosseum floor isn’t included with all basic tickets. Because of preservation efforts and limited space, special tickets or guided tours are often needed.

Make sure to check up-to-date Colosseum hours before you go, as opening times can change with the seasons or special events. Planning ahead helps you avoid disappointment and lets you fully enjoy every part of this ancient landmark.

Insider Tips for Your Ancient Rome Visit

Here are some tips to make your trip smooth and memorable:

  • Book early: Tickets with floor access sell out quickly.
  • Choose a guided tour: Guides bring the stories to life and show hidden details.
  • Check official Colosseum hours online before your visit.
  • Wear comfortable shoes: You’ll walk over ancient stone and uneven surfaces.
  • Visit early or late: Avoid busy crowds and enjoy the golden sunlight over the arena.
